U.S. Highway 180 (US 180) is a US highway that runs from Valle, Arizona, to Hudson Oaks, Texas. A child route of U.S. Route 80, the Texas portion of U.S. 180 consists of two distinct segments. Separated by an approximately 105 mile stretch of roadway travelling through southeast New Mexico, the first segment travels through far west Texas from the New Mexico border near El Paso to the New Mexico border approximately 25 miles west of Carlsbad, New Mexico. The second segment begins on the Texas state line between Hobbs, New Mexico, and Seminole and travels east across the lower Panhandle and Cross Timbers regions, passing through the towns of Lamesa, Snyder, Albany, and Breckenridge. The terminus of the second segment, which is also the highway's eastern terminus, is at an interchange with Interstate 20 (I-20) in Hudson Oaks, between Weatherford and Fort Worth.
